Learn More About Sweet-Tart Specialists Coming to Sawtelle

Supita opening at 2010 Sawtelle

By Dolores Quintana

Supita, the sweet-tart specialist coming to Sawtelle Japantown has revealed more about what they will be bringing to the Westside at 2010 Sawtelle. 

During a phone interview, Claire Lam, spokesperson for Supita, said, “We are actually a mother company called Sweet Distribution and Management Incorporated (SDMN), which manages all of these brands. We mainly bring over brands from Hong Kong and China. Supita isn’t established in Hong Kong, it is the sister company of Simply Splendid Bakery that is located in Alhambra here in Los Angeles.”

When asked about what patrons can expect from Supita, Lam said that the restaurant will specialize in tarts, but will have other kinds of pastry and cake. Supita will also carry drinks that are popular in Hong Kong. They will have tarts and beverages that are specialties of the Hong Kong market and ones that are similar to the items on the mother bakery’s menu Simply Splendid Bakery. Lam mentioned Hong Kong-style milk tea and lemon tea. Another item listed on the Simply Splendid Bakery menu is Yuanyang Tea, which is a mixture of tea and coffee for a super caffeinated drink so perhaps that will be on the menu as well. 

Lam specifically mentioned that Supita would have Hong Kong egg tarts and Portuguese egg tarts on the menu. A look at the Simply Splendid menu shows an exciting and long list of cakes, which include chocolate, vanilla cream, hazelnut chocolate crispy, red bean, green tea red bean, chestnut, coffee, mango, peach, strawberry and durian cakes. Lam said that they are always trying new and different types of tarts and cakes, so it is likely that they will be doing seasonal specials as well. 

According to Lam, they are in the last stages of renovating the restaurant and are waiting for final permit approvals from the city. They would like to open in early September, but because of the process involved and delays built in because of the ongoing pandemic, Lam said that while they hope for early September, they said that it could be later in the month, but that an opening in September was their goal. Supita sounds like a very exciting addition to Sawtelle and a new full-service bakery that will bring the Hong Kong style to the Westside.
